Inventors list

Assignees list

Classification tree browser

Top 100 Inventors

Top 100 Assignees


Bohrer

Dror Bohrer, Nesher IL

Patent application numberDescriptionPublished
20110029847PROCESSING OF DATA INTEGRITY FIELD - A network communication device includes a host interface, which is coupled to communicate with a host processor, having a memory, so as to receive a work request to convey one or more data blocks over a network. The work request specifies a memory region of a given data size, and at least one data integrity field (DIF), having a given field size, is associated with the data blocks. Network interface circuitry is configured to execute an input/output (I/O) data transfer operation responsively to the work request so as to transfer to or from the memory a quantity of data that differs from the data size of the memory region by a multiple of the field size, while adding the at least one DIF to the transferred data or removing the at least one DIF from the transferred data.02-03-2011

Erik Bohrer, Maxdorf DE

Patent application numberDescriptionPublished
20120118446AQUEOUS METAL QUENCHING MEDIUM - Aqueous metal quenching media comprising vinyllactam/acrylamide copolymers05-17-2012
20120130028PROCESS FOR THE PREPARATION OF LOW-PEROXIDE CROSSLINKED VINYLLACTAM POLYMER - Process for the preparation of low-peroxide crosslinked vinyllactam polymer by free-radical polymerization in the presence of at least one organic substance acting as antioxidant, low-peroxide crosslinked vinyllactam polymer obtainable by this process, and its use.05-24-2012

James Bohrer, Seattle, WA US

Patent application numberDescriptionPublished
20120030682Dynamic Priority Assessment of Multimedia for Allocation of Recording and Delivery Resources - Techniques are provided to allocate resources used for recording multimedia or to retrieve recorded content and deliver it to a recipient. A request associated with multimedia for access to resources is received. A context associated with the multimedia is determined. Resources for the multimedia are allocated based on the context.02-02-2012

Jeffrey R. Bohrer, St. Peters, MO US

Patent application numberDescriptionPublished
20110140567Low Noise Rotor or Stator of an Electric Motor or Generator and Method of Assembling the Same - A stator or rotor of an electric motor or generator comprises a core formed of ferromagnetic material having a plurality of teeth arranged circumferentially about an axis. In one aspect of the invention, at least one retaining member connects the end portions of at least two of the teeth to each other in a manner inhibiting relative movement between said tooth end portions. By inhibiting relative movement between said tooth end portions, vibration is reduced. Vibration can also be reduced by welding interior surfaces of a core to each other. Reducing the vibration reduces the noise emissions of the rotor or stator during operation.06-16-2011
20110193433Stator with Cavity for Retaining Wires and Method of Forming the Same - A stator comprises a cavity formed into the insulator of the windings. The non-wound wire sections that extend from the windings and the electrical conductors attached thereto are housed within the cavity. A cap locks onto the stator insulator and prevents the non-wound sections of wire from migrating out of the cavity.08-11-2011

Lorenz Bohrer, Berlin DE

Patent application numberDescriptionPublished
20090048777Method for Controlling the Display of a Geographical Map in a Vehicle and Display Apparatus for that Purpose - In a method for controlling a map display in a vehicle, a display device is controlled such that a section of a geographical map is displayed in a spatially non-linear scale. A display apparatus for displaying a geographical map includes a control unit and a display device, connected to the control unit, a map section, the control unit including an arithmetic-logic unit by which data assigned to the geographical map is able to be converted into display data, taking a spatially non-linear scale into consideration. A navigation system includes such a display apparatus.02-19-2009
20110007006METHOD AND APPARATUS FOR OPERATING A DEVICE IN A VEHICLE WITH A VOICE CONTROLLER - In a method for operating a device in a vehicle, an operating step is selected and a function associated with the operating step is performed. The operation of selecting the operating step automatically activates a voice controller for input following the operating step. An apparatus for operating a device in a vehicle has a display apparatus for displaying operating steps, a first operating unit for haptic input for selecting an operating step, a voice control unit for voice input for selecting an operating step, and a control unit which is coupled to the display apparatus, the first operating unit and the voice control unit and can be used to generate control signals for performing a function associated with a selected operating step. The control unit is designed in such a manner that the operation of selecting an operating step automatically activates the voice control unit for input following the operating step.01-13-2011
20110121958METHOD AND DEVICE FOR GENERATING A USER RECOGNITION SIGNAL - In a device and a method to produce a user recognition signal upon an actuation by a user in a vehicle using a control unit linked with a transmitter and receiver which are disposed relative to one another to set up a user-specific high frequency transmission path therebetween upon actuation by the the user, at least one HF signal is provided and transferred through the body of the user, the HF transfer is evaluated to determine the user-specific transmission path to identify the user, and a user recognition signal is produced that identifies the user, wherein using at least one detection unit an action of the user is detected or an action presence is monitored, and in the detection of the action an action signal is produced, and the transmitter only provides the one HF transmission signal after or upon the existence of an action signal.05-26-2011

Patent applications by Lorenz Bohrer, Berlin DE

Patrick Bohrer, Austin, TX US

Patent application numberDescriptionPublished
20120297326SCALABLE GESTURE-BASED DEVICE CONTROL - A method for providing control signals may include, but is not limited to: detecting a first user input associated with at least one graphical user interface element; transmitting one or more control signals associated with the at least one graphical user interface element in response to the first user input; detecting a second user input associated with a grouping of two or more graphical user interface elements; and transmitting one or more control signals associated with the grouping of two or more graphical user interface elements in response to the second user input.11-22-2012
20120297347GESTURE-BASED NAVIGATION CONTROL - A user interface may be provided by: displaying a graphical user interface including at least one graphical user interface element; receiving at least one gesture-based user input; displaying a graphical user interface including the at least one graphical user interface element and one or more graphical user interface elements that are hierarchically dependent from the at least one graphical user interface element in response to the at least one gesture-based user input.11-22-2012

Patrick Bohrer, Hegenheim FR

Patent application numberDescriptionPublished
20080275275Process for the Preparation of Ubihydroquinones and Ubiquinones - A process for the preparation of ubihydroquinones and ubiquinones by condensation of a prenol or isoprenol with a hydroquinone or derivative thereof in the presence of 0.005-1.0 mol % of a catalyst which is a Broensted-acid, a Lewis-acid from the group consisting of a derivative of Bi or In or an element of group 3 of the periodic table of the elements, a heteropolyacid, an NH- or a CH-acidic compound, and optionally oxidizing the ubihydroquinone obtained.11-06-2008

Patrick J. Bohrer, Cedar Park, TX US

Patent application numberDescriptionPublished
20120144395Inter-Thread Data Communications In A Computer Processor - Inter-thread data communications in a computer processor with multiple hardware threads of execution, each hardware thread operatively coupled for communications through an inter-thread communications controller, where inter-thread communications is carried out by the inter-thread communications controller and includes: registering, responsive to one or more RECEIVE opcodes, one or more receiving threads executing the RECEIVE opcodes; receiving, from a SEND opcode of a sending thread, specifications of a number of derived messages to be sent to receiving threads and a base value; generating the derived messages, incrementing the base value once for each registered receiving thread so that each derived message includes a single integer as a separate increment of the base value; sending, to each registered receiving thread, a derived message; and returning, to the sending thread, an actual number of derived messages received by receiving threads.06-07-2012
20120144396Creating A Thread Of Execution In A Computer Processor - Creating a thread of execution in a computer processor, including copying, by a hardware processor opcode called by a user-level process, with no operating system involvement, register contents from a parent hardware thread to a child hardware thread, the child hardware thread being in a wait state, and changing, by the hardware processor opcode, the child hardware thread from the wait state to an ephemeral run state.06-07-2012
20120173928Analyzing Simulated Operation Of A Computer - Analyzing simulated operation of a computer including loading user-defined dynamically linked analysis libraries that each include specifications of events to be traced for analysis, including: executing, in separate hardware threads, one trace buffer handler for each analysis library, and associating, with each trace buffer handler, one or more analysis functions; translating static binary instructions for the simulated computer into binary instructions for the executing computer, including: inserting, into the translation, implementing code for each specification of an event to be traced and inserting, into the translation for each static instruction, a memory address of a separate static instruction buffer; executing the translation, including executing the implementing code and generating, in a trace buffer, one or more trace records for each specified event; and processing the trace buffer, including calling analysis functions and associating by the analysis functions through the separate static instruction buffers event analysis data with static instructions.07-05-2012
20120216204CREATING A THREAD OF EXECUTION IN A COMPUTER PROCESSOR - Creating a thread of execution in a computer processor, including copying, by a hardware processor opcode called by a user-level process, with no operating system involvement, register contents from a parent hardware thread to a child hardware thread, the child hardware thread being in a wait state, and changing, by the hardware processor opcode, the child hardware thread from the wait state to an ephemeral run state.08-23-2012

Patrick Joseph Bohrer, Austin, TX US

Patent application numberDescriptionPublished
20120198459ASSIST THREAD FOR INJECTING CACHE MEMORY IN A MICROPROCESSOR - A data processing system includes a microprocessor having access to multiple levels of cache memories. The microprocessor executes a main thread compiled from a source code object. The system includes a processor for executing an assist thread also derived from the source code object. The assist thread includes memory reference instructions of the main thread and only those arithmetic instructions required to resolve the memory reference instructions. A scheduler configured to schedule the assist thread in conjunction with the corresponding execution thread is configured to execute the assist thread ahead of the execution thread by a determinable threshold such as the number of main processor cycles or the number of code instructions. The assist thread may execute in the main processor or in a dedicated assist processor that makes direct memory accesses to one of the lower level cache memory elements.08-02-2012

Rick Bohrer, Seattle, WA US

Patent application numberDescriptionPublished
20110022464OPTIMIZING ADS BY CUSTOMIZATION FOR A TARGET DEVICE - Computer systems, methods and media for optimizing an advertisement are provided. Creative elements for an ad campaign are received from an advertiser. In response to an ad call from a target device, device information, application information, and user information are accessed. Based on the accessed information and the creative elements of the dynamic creative, a customized ad is created that includes an optimized set of creative elements for the target device and the application such that the user gets an optimized user experience regardless of the target device presenting the ad.01-27-2011

Robert D. Bohrer, Troy, OH US

Patent application numberDescriptionPublished
20090126002SYSTEM AND METHOD FOR SAFEGUARDING AND PROCESSING CONFIDENTIAL INFORMATION - One aspect of the invention is a method for providing restricted access to confidential services without impacting the security of a network. The method includes using a gateway to isolate one or more components providing confidential services from one or more other portions of an enterprise network. A first communication directed to a selected one of the one or more components may be received at the gateway. A determination may be made as to whether the first communication is user traffic or management traffic. The first communication may then be authenticated. If the first communication is user traffic, the first communication is forwarded to a component providing the confidential services. If the first communication is management traffic, the first communication is encrypted and forwarded to a component providing the confidential services. Additionally, components of the sub-network may be monitored to identify malicious changes.05-14-2009

Roland Bohrer, Saint-Julien De Ratz FR

Patent application numberDescriptionPublished
20110116773METHOD AND DEVICE FOR CONTROLLING PLAYING SPEED OF A COMPRESSED DIGITAL VIDEO SEQUENCE (TRICKMODE) - A method of playing a compressed digital video sequence, comprising steps comprising attributing to each frame a display duration determined as a function of a playing speed set point, and at each period of a frame synchronization signal: if a display duration cumulative value is equal to or greater than a threshold value corresponding to the period of the synchronization signal, playing a previously acquired decoded frame and decreasing the cumulative value of the threshold value; and if the present cumulative value is less than the threshold value, acquiring a new decoded frame and adding the display duration attributed to the newly acquired frame to the cumulative value, until the cumulative value is equal to or greater than the threshold value, playing a last decoded frame acquired and decreasing the cumulative value of the threshold value.05-19-2011

Stefan Bohrer, St. Wendel DE

Patent application numberDescriptionPublished
20090145682PROPULSION DRIVE SYSTEM FOR A UTILITY VEHICLE - A propulsion drive system is provided for a utility vehicle having an internal combustion engine, a hydraulic pump connected, so as to be driven by the internal combustion engine wherein the fluid displacement of the hydraulic pump can be varied by a first actuator. A hydraulic motor is connected by a line conducting hydraulic fluid to the hydraulic pump wherein the fluid displacement of the hydraulic motor can be varied by a second actuator and is connected so as to drive at least one propulsion device in engagement with the ground. A control arrangement is connected with a speed input arrangement. The control arrangement is operated so as to control the first actuator and the second actuator in such a way that the overall efficiency of the hydraulic pump and the hydraulic motor is at a maximum.06-11-2009
20100186362SELF-PROPELLED AGRICULTURAL HARVESTING MACHINE HAVING TWO INTERNAL COMBUSTION ENGINES - A self-propelled harvesting machine is provided that has operating devices to take-up and/or process harvested crop, which can be driven by means of a drive belt, that can be driven by a belt pulley about an axis of rotation extending horizontally and transverse to the forward operating direction of the harvesting machine. Two internal combustion engines are provided on the harvesting machine and each are supported on the frame arranged side by side alongside each other relative to the forward operating direction, with crankshafts extending in the forward operating direction. A connecting gearbox is arranged ahead of the internal combustion engines in the forward direction of operation and is connected or can be connected so as to drive with the first crankshaft, the second crankshaft and the belt pulley. The connecting gearbox includes two angle gearboxes that are connected to a transverse shaft arranged in the transverse direction that is connected or may be connected, in turn, with the belt pulley.07-29-2010
20120067037Drive System For An Infeed Conveyor Of A Harvester - The invention relates to a drive system for an infeed conveyor (03-22-2012

Patent applications by Stefan Bohrer, St. Wendel DE

Timothy H. Bohrer, Chicago, IL US

Patent application numberDescriptionPublished
20100213191Low Crystallinity Susceptor Films - A microwave energy interactive structure comprises a polymer film having a crystallinity of less than about 50%, and a layer of microwave energy interactive material on the polymer film. The layer of microwave energy interactive material is operative for converting at least a portion of impinging microwave energy into thermal energy.08-26-2010
20100213192Plasma Treated Susceptor Films - A microwave energy interactive structure comprises a polymer film having a pair of opposed sides, a first side of the pair of opposed sides being plasma treated, and a layer of microwave energy interactive material supported on the first side of the polymer film.08-26-2010
20110011854LOW CRYSTALLINITY SUSCEPTOR FILMS - A microwave energy interactive structure comprises a polymer film having a birefringence (n01-20-2011
20110233202Microwave Interactive Flexible Packaging - A package configured to receive a food item for storage and heating therein is disclosed. The package includes an opening and a closure mechanism and comprises an insulating microwave material. A plurality of packages in a stacked relation also is provided.09-29-2011
20120279956Microwave Energy Interactive Pouches - A flexible microwave heating package for food includes a first panel and a second panel joined to one another in a facing relationship, and a third panel joined to the first panel and the second panel. The first panel and second panel define walls of the package and the third panel defines a base of the package. The first panel and second panel may each include microwave energy interactive material operative for reflecting at least a portion of incident microwave energy.11-08-2012

Patent applications by Timothy H. Bohrer, Chicago, IL US

Zane Bohrer, Frisco, TX US

Patent application numberDescriptionPublished
20100082384SYSTEMS AND METHODS FOR COMPREHENSIVE CONSUMER RELATIONSHIP MANAGEMENT - A comprehensive consumer relationship management system is disclosed. The comprehensive consumer relationship management system includes dispute resolution, customized data modeling, advertising assistance, and secure communications. By providing value added features, the comprehensive consumer relationship management system may strengthen consumer relationships by, for example, creating detailed data analysis to aid in making business decisions and facilitating secure communications among diverse consumers.04-01-2010